The cheapest way to get from Bridgwater to Clevedon is to line 404 bus and bus which costs £5 - £11 and takes 1h 29m.
The fastest way to get from Bridgwater to Clevedon is to drive which takes 29 min and costs £6 - £9.
No, there is no direct bus from Bridgwater station to Clevedon. However, there are services departing from Bus Station and arriving at Curzon Cinema via Interchange.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 29m.
The distance between Bridgwater and Clevedon is 27 miles. The road distance is 25.2 miles.
The best way to get from Bridgwater to Clevedon without a car is to train and bus which takes 1h 14m and costs £12 - £22.
It takes approximately 1h 14m to get from Bridgwater to Clevedon, including transfers.
Bridgwater to Clevedon b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Bus Station.
Bridgwater to Clevedon bus services, operated by National Express, arrive at Interchange station.
Yes, the driving distance between Bridgwater to Clevedon is 25 miles. It takes approximately 29 min to drive from Bridgwater to Clevedon.
